Transaction 4396413529502528af802616fb55432e3253d8af4ac8189ce8002c22189423e3
1 Input
1 Output
-
4396413529502528af802616fb55432e3253d8af4ac8189ce8002c22189423e3:0
- value
- 1882597
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 368594f62e9fcf3368ad75639f6bad058a94a5b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 15yHWnrr5mB1rMQ2YfCzbg5NqbmzScSvgD